Bonds offer a stable avenue to grow your wealth while mitigating risk. By investing in bonds, you become a lender to governments or corporations, generating regular interest payments known as distributions. The maturity date of a bond signifies when the principal amount is refunded to you. Bonds can be particularly advantageous for investors seeking steady income.

Generate Steady Returns Through Bond Investments

Bonds can serve as a valuable asset in any well-diversified portfolio. Their predictability makes them an attractive option for investors seeking steady returns, particularly in uncertain market situations. In contrast to equities, bonds generally offer guaranteed income through regular interest payments. While bond earnings may not be as substantial as those of stocks, they provide a valuable source of cash flow and can help to mitigate the overall exposure of your portfolio.

By careful selection of bonds with diverse maturities and credit qualifications, investors can fine-tune their bond portfolio to meet their personalized financial goals.

Diversify Your Portfolio with Bond Holdings

A well-structured financial portfolio benefits from a diversified strategy. Bonds, often underestimated, play a crucial role in mitigating volatility. Holding bonds can provide your portfolio with predictability, counterbalancing the inherent uncertainty of equities.

By incorporating a variety of of bonds, such as government obligations, corporate notes, or municipal investments, you can optimize your portfolio's overall performance. Bonds often produce a steady stream of interest payments, providing a valuable source of earnings for your portfolio.

Additionally, bonds can serve as a safe haven against economic recessions. During periods of turmoil, the demand for bonds often soars, leading to price appreciation.

It is crucial to speak with a qualified financial advisor to determine the optimal allocation of bonds within your capital plan.
